Inclusion criteria

Inclusion criteria: Adult patient undergoing craniotomy for unruptured cerebral aneurysm ligation

Exclusion criteria

Exclusion criteria: 80 years old or older or under 20 years old Order of surgery other than the first Cerebral aneurysms that cause symptoms such as pain, vision problems, or abnormal sensations Infratentorial cerebral aneurysms such as cerebral aneurysms that develop in the basilar and vertebral arteries or their branches Craniotomy other than keyhole craniotomy American Society of Anesthesiologists physical status (ASA PS) 3 or higher Dementia, cancer, or scalp disease Past psychiatric medication and treatment history History of past craniotomy or scalp incision Allergy to local anesthetics, narcotic analgesics, non-steroid anti-inflammatory drugs Use of chronic narcotic pain relievers Lack of communication or ability to complete QoR-40
